How to Calculate 35 out of 44 as a Percentage
Divide the numerator by the denominator, then multiply by 100. The result is the percentage score.
Step by step: 35 divided by 44 equals 0.7955 as a decimal. Multiply that by 100 and you get 79.5%. On the standard US plus/minus grading scale, 79.5% is a C+ grade, equal to 2.3 GPA on the 4.0 scale.
What 79.5% Means as a C+ Grade
Average. A 2.3 GPA clears the 2.0 academic probation threshold but falls below the 2.5 GPA floor for many financial aid and honors-program requirements.
At most US colleges and high schools, the minimum passing score is 60%. A score of 79.5% clears that threshold, so 35 out of 44 is a passing grade. Always verify with your institution, as some programs require a C or higher (70%) for courses that count toward major requirements.
